One of the first steps in building a successful startup is comprehending your target market. Recognizing the requirements and preferences of your audience is crucial for crafting a product or service that resonates with them.
Conduct in-depth market research to acquire insights into consumer behavior, rival analysis, and industry trends. Via understanding the landscape in which your business operates, you can take informed decisions that drive progress.
Your identity is greater than just a logo or a name; it is the image that customers have of your business. Building a strong brand identity is vital for setting yourself apart in a competitive market.
Define your brand's values, mission, and unique selling points. Develop a compelling brand story that resonates with your audience and sets you apart from competitors. Consistency in branding across all touchpoints is key to creating brand loyalty.
In today's fast-paced business world, novelty is vital for long-term success. Embracing new ideas and technologies can offer your startup a competitive edge and place you for growth.
Encourage creativity and innovative thinking among your team members. Create a work culture that fosters innovation and welcomes experimentation. Via fostering a culture of innovation, you can unleash new opportunities for growth and progress.
Flexibility and adjustability are vital traits for entrepreneurs in a dynamic marketplace. Remaining open to change and willing to pivot your plan when necessary can aid your startup succeed in the face of uncertainty.
Stay agile and flexible in the face of industry changes. Monitor trends, listen to customer feedback, and be proactive in spotting opportunities for development. Through staying alert and adapting to change, you can align your startup for long-term success.
